Many companies ready to invest in TAPI gas pipeline project

Ashgabat, Turkmenistan, Dec. 30

By Huseyn Hasanov - Trend:

Many companies have expressed desire to participate in the construction of the Turkmenistan-Afghanistan-Pakistan-India (TAPI) gas pipeline, Turkmen President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ov said.

Berdimuhamedov made the remarks at the government meeting, the Turkmen Dovlet Habarlary state news agency reported Dec. 30.

"I think that ensuring the high quality of the planned work in accordance with the schedule will increase the number of potential investors," the president said.

Turkmenistan started to construct its TAPI section in December 2015. Annual capacity of the gas pipeline will be up to 33 billion cubic meters.

Earlier, representatives of the Asian Development Bank, the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development and the Japanese government expressed their interest in TAPI financing. The Islamic Development Bank has already allocated a loan worth $700 million for Turkmenistan to construct its TAPI section.
